| 1 | | AN ACT concerning education.
|
| 2 | | Be it enacted by the People of the State of Illinois,
|
| 3 | | represented in the General Assembly:
|
| 4 | | Section 5. The University of Illinois Trustees Act is |
| 5 | | amended by changing Section 1 as follows:
|
| 6 | | (110 ILCS 310/1) (from Ch. 144, par. 41)
|
| 7 | | Sec. 1.
The Board of Trustees of the University of Illinois |
| 8 | | shall consist
of the Governor and at least 12 trustees. Nine |
| 9 | | trustees shall be
appointed by the Governor, by and with the |
| 10 | | advice and consent of
the Senate. The other trustees shall be |
| 11 | | students, of whom one student shall
be selected from each |
| 12 | | University campus.
|
| 13 | | Each student trustee shall serve a term of one year, |
| 14 | | beginning on July 1 or
on the date of his or her selection, |
| 15 | | whichever is later, and expiring on the
next succeeding June |
| 16 | | 30.
|
| 17 | | Each trustee shall have all of the privileges of |
| 18 | | membership, except that only
one student trustee shall have the |
| 19 | | right to cast a legally binding vote. The
Governor shall |
| 20 | | designate which one of the student trustees shall possess, for
|
| 21 | | his or her entire term, the right to cast a legally binding |
| 22 | | vote. Each student
trustee who does not possess the right to |
| 23 | | cast a legally binding vote shall
have the right to cast an |

| 1 | | advisory vote and the right to make and second
motions and to |
| 2 | | attend executive sessions.
|
| 3 | | Each trustee shall be governed by the same conflict of |
| 4 | | interest standards.
Pursuant to those standards, it shall not |
| 5 | | be a conflict of interest for a
student trustee to vote on |
| 6 | | matters pertaining to students generally, such as
tuition and |
| 7 | | fees. However, it shall be a conflict of interest for a student
|
| 8 | | trustee to vote on
faculty member
tenure or promotion.
Student |
| 9 | | trustees shall be chosen by campus-wide
student election, and |
| 10 | | the
student trustee designated by the Governor to
possess a |
| 11 | | legally binding vote shall be
one of the students selected by |
| 12 | | this method. A student trustee who does not
possess a legally |
| 13 | | binding vote on a
measure at a meeting of the
Board or any of |
| 14 | | its committees shall not be considered a trustee
for the |
| 15 | | purpose
of determining whether a quorum is present at the time |
| 16 | | that measure is voted
upon. To be eligible for selection as a
|
| 17 | | student trustee
and
to be eligible to remain as a voting or |
| 18 | | nonvoting student trustee,
a student trustee must be a resident |
| 19 | | of this State,
must have and maintain a
grade point average |
| 20 | | that is equivalent to at least 2.5 on a 4.0 scale, and must
be a |
| 21 | | full time student enrolled at all times during his or her term |
| 22 | | of office
except
for that part of the term which follows
the |
| 23 | | completion of the last full regular semester of an academic |
| 24 | | year and
precedes the first full regular semester of the |
| 25 | | succeeding academic year at the
University (sometimes commonly |
| 26 | | referred to as the summer
session or summer
school). If a |

| 1 | | voting or nonvoting student trustee
fails to
continue to meet |
| 2 | | or maintain the residency, minimum grade point average, or
|
| 3 | | enrollment requirement established by this Section, his
or her |
| 4 | | membership on the Board shall be deemed to have terminated by |
| 5 | | operation
of law. The University may not use residency for |
| 6 | | tuition purposes as a factor in making the determination that a |
| 7 | | student is or is not a resident of this State. Any one of the |
| 8 | | The following factors shall positively demonstrate residency |
| 9 | | in this State for the purposes of the residency requirement for |
| 10 | | student trustees and candidates for student trustee:
|
| 11 | | (1) evidence of the student's Illinois domicile for at |
| 12 | | least the previous 6 months; |
| 13 | | (2) evidence of the student's current, valid Illinois |
| 14 | | driver's license; or and |
| 15 | | (3) evidence of the student's valid Illinois voter |
| 16 | | registration. |
| 17 | | A positive demonstration of residency in this State for student |
| 18 | | trustees and candidates for student trustees under this Section |
| 19 | | does not apply to residency requirements for tuition purposes. |
| 20 | | If a voting student trustee resigns or otherwise ceases to |
| 21 | | serve on the
Board, the Governor shall, within 30 days, |
| 22 | | designate one of the remaining
student trustees to possess the |
| 23 | | right to cast a legally binding vote
for the remainder of his |
| 24 | | or her term. If a nonvoting student trustee resigns
or
|
| 25 | | otherwise ceases to serve on the Board, the chief executive of |
| 26 | | the
student government from that campus shall, within 30 days, |

| 1 | | select
a new nonvoting student trustee to serve for the |
| 2 | | remainder of the term.
|
| 3 | | No more than 5 of the 9 appointed trustees
shall be |
| 4 | | affiliated
with the same political party.
Each trustee |
| 5 | | appointed by the Governor must be a resident of this State. A
|
| 6 | | failure to meet
or maintain this residency requirement |
| 7 | | constitutes a resignation from and
creates a
vacancy in the |
| 8 | | Board.
The term of office of each appointed trustee
shall be 6 |
| 9 | | years from the third Monday in January of each odd numbered |
| 10 | | year.
The regular terms of office of the
appointed trustees |
| 11 | | shall be staggered so that 3 terms expire in each
odd-numbered |
| 12 | | year.
|
| 13 | | Vacancies for appointed trustees shall be filled for the |
| 14 | | unexpired term
in the same manner as
original appointments. If |
| 15 | | a vacancy in membership occurs at a time when the
Senate is not |
| 16 | | in session, the Governor shall make temporary appointments |
| 17 | | until
the next meeting of the Senate, when he shall appoint |
| 18 | | persons to fill such
memberships for the remainder of their |
| 19 | | respective terms. If the Senate is not
in session when |
| 20 | | appointments for a full term are made, appointments shall be
|
| 21 | | made as in the case of vacancies.
|
| 22 | | No action of the board shall be invalidated by reason of |
| 23 | | any vacancies on
the board, or by reason of any failure to |
| 24 | | select student trustees.
|
| 25 | | (Source: P.A. 98-778, eff. 7-21-14.)
